I enter every single session with one simple question, why? Why does your shoulder hurt? Why does your back hurt? Often both therapist and client can get wrapped up in the what, what can be done to fix the problem? What is the issue with my foot? If you find the why you’ll get your what.

Movements Can Be Broken Down Easily Online

Since going into lockdown I have found online sessions to be just as effective in answering the why as face to face appointments. Take this example, say you perform a shoulder movement standing up and the movement is restricted and painful, but when you lie down the exact same movement becomes pain free and smooth. Why?

Well two potential reasons, either your shoulder is unstable in a standing position but when led down your body feels safe to move OR your shoulder isn’t the issue at all, but in standing due to postural distortions it is being held back from achieving full potential.

Now we have two schools of thought. Why would your shoulder be unstable? Do you have a history of any collar bone breaks, breaks further down the arm, ligament tears or shoulder dislocations? Or are the main bulk of your historical traumas elsewhere in the body, in which case what lines of movement (better known as fascia) could be impacting your shoulder when stood up, that are relaxed when led down?

Exploring Movement Potential Is No Issue Over A Camera

We then have the ability to explore and observe movement potential elsewhere over a camera and can also put different stimulus into your body to see how the shoulder reacts. What if you turn the neck to one side? Bite down on your jaw? Hold your breath? What if we get you press hard into an area of tissue seemingly unrelated, do things alter? Do any of these change your pain or improve your movement? If so that is valuable information that will get us ever closer to completing the puzzle and finding your why!
